Therapy and Treatment
Our approach focuses on evidence-based techniques designed to address the specific issues the young person is dealing with.
We utilise evidence-based interventions including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behaviour Therapy Skills (DBT Skills), Motivational Interviewing (MI), Strengths Based Approaches, and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T).
Our approach involves providing support in a calm and reassuring space to help you and your children feel at ease.

Assessments
Our services include assessments for ADHD,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D), specific learning disorders (SLD), giftedness, and intellectual disability (ID), along with identifying cognitive and academic strengths and weaknesses to support educational planning.
Our assessments aim to identify if one or more underlying factors are contributing to the difficulties the young person presents with. Each assessment is in-depth and includes screening for other possible causes or concerns.
Common Conditions We Support
Regardless of whether your child is dealing with typical concerns, more pronounced symptoms, or already has a diagnosis, we are here to help. We support a range of difficulties, including but not limited to:
- Anxiety, including phobias, social anxiety, separation anxiety, generalised anxiety, and perfectionism
- Depression
- Obsessive Compulsive Disorder and other obsessive-compulsive behaviours, including tics
- Exam stress and other academic concerns
- Procrastination
- Sleep problems
- Oppositional behaviour
- Behavioural difficulties
-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D)
-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D)
- Social difficulties, including bullying in both neurotypical and neurodivergent children
- Parenting issues

Booking with us
Seeing a psychologist does not require a referral, but if you would like to claim a Medicare rebate, you can consult your GP, specialist paediatrician, or psychiatrist to arrange a Mental Health Care Plan.
You generally don’t need a referral to claim through private health insurance, but it’s important to check the specific requirements of your policy with your private health insurer.

What To Expect and How to Book
No referral is necessary to book an appointment, but a Medicare rebate can be accessed by obtaining a Mental Health Care Plan from your GP. For private health insurance rebates, referrals are generally not required, though you should verify your coverage details with your insurer.For children under 16, we typically arrange an initial consultation with one or both guardians, with a preference for both to attend if possible. For families where parents are separated, individual consultations with each parent can be organised.
The goal of this is to obtain key background information, enable open communication, and plan the most suitable next steps. For children aged 16 and above, the initial session involves both the young person and their parent/s, often with time spent together and individually with the psychologist.
Telehealth services are available. For in-clinic visits, please advise us of any mobility challenges, as there are stairs at the clinic entrance.
